Historical Landmarks in London

London, a city steeped in history, offers a plethora of historical landmarks that narrate tales of its rich past. From the moment you step off your airport transfer, you're immersed in a world of cultural destinations that are a testament to London's historical significance. The iconic Tower of London,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, is a must-visit. It has served as a royal palace, prison, treasury, and even a zoo! The British Museum, home to millions of works from all continents, is another cultural treasure trove. The majestic Buckingham Palace, the official residence of the Queen, is a symbol of the British monarchy's enduring legacy. The Palace of Westminster, with its iconic Big Ben, is a stunning example of Gothic Revival architecture. The historic St. Paul's Cathedral, a masterpiece of Sir Christopher Wren, is another must-see. Each landmark is a chapter in London's history, waiting to be explored.

London's Literary History

London's literary history is as rich and diverse as the city itself. From the time of Chaucer and Shakespeare to the modern era of Virginia Woolf and J.K. Rowling, the city has been a source of inspiration for countless authors. As you travel from the airport to the heart of the city, you can explore the literary landmarks that have shaped the world's literature. Visit the British Library, home to the Magna Carta and original manuscripts of iconic works. Wander through Bloomsbury, the neighborhood that inspired Woolf's novels. Stop by the Charles Dickens Museum, located in the author's former home. Don't miss the chance to visit the Globe Theatre, a replica of Shakespeare's original playhouse. London's literary history is a fascinating journey, one that begins the moment you step off the plane.

Historical Pubs in London

London, a city steeped in history, offers a unique way to explore its past - through its historical pubs. These establishments, some dating back centuries, are cultural destinations in their own right. As you step off your airport transfer, consider visiting these iconic watering holes. The Ye Olde Cheshire Cheese, rebuilt after the Great Fire of London in 1666, has welcomed literary greats like Charles Dickens. The Prospect of Whitby, London's oldest riverside pub, offers stunning views of the Thames and a glimpse into its maritime past. The George Inn, the only surviving galleried coaching inn in London, was frequented by Shakespeare and Dickens. The Spaniards Inn, a 16th-century pub, is steeped in literary history, with connections to Dickens, Byron, and Keats. These historical pubs not only offer a pint of traditional ale but also a taste of London's rich history, making them must-visit destinations for any history enthusiast.

London's Royal History

London's royal history is a captivating tale that has shaped the city's cultural landscape. As you journey from the airport, your first glimpse of the city may include iconic landmarks like the Tower of London, a historic castle that has served variously as a royal palace, prison, treasury, and even a zoo. Further into the city, Buckingham Palace stands as a symbol of the continuing royal tradition, serving as the official residence of the Queen. Kensington Palace, the childhood home of Queen Victoria and current residence of several members of the royal family, offers a glimpse into royal life past and present. The grandeur of Westminster Abbey, where monarchs have been crowned and buried since 1066, is a testament to the enduring legacy of the monarchy. Exploring London's royal history provides a fascinating insight into the traditions, triumphs, and tribulations that have shaped this vibrant city.

Historical Parks and Gardens in London

London, a city steeped in history, offers a plethora of historical parks and gardens that serve as cultural destinations for history enthusiasts. These green spaces, easily accessible via airport transfer, provide a unique insight into the city's past. Hyde Park, one of the city's eight Royal Parks, is a prime example. Once a hunting ground for Henry VIII, it now serves as a tranquil retreat from the bustling city. Similarly, the Kensington Gardens, originally the private gardens of Kensington Palace, are home to several historical monuments and buildings. The Regent's Park, designed by John Nash, showcases a blend of English and French garden styles. Meanwhile, the Greenwich Park, a UNESCO World Heritage site, offers panoramic views of the city and the River Thames. Exploring these historical parks and gardens in London not only offers a breath of fresh air but also a journey through the city's rich history.

London's Architectural History

London's architectural history is a captivating journey that tells the story of a city that has evolved over centuries. From the iconic Tower of London, a Norman fortress dating back to the 11th century, to the modern Shard, a 95-story skyscraper, London's skyline is a testament to its rich and diverse architectural heritage. The city's architecture is a blend of Roman, Medieval, Tudor, Victorian, and contemporary styles, each reflecting the era's social, political, and cultural context. The grandeur of St. Paul's Cathedral, the elegance of Buckingham Palace, the Gothic splendor of the Houses of Parliament, and the innovative design of the Gherkin all contribute to London's unique architectural landscape.
